A deciduous ornamental tree known for its narrow, upright columnar habit and formal architectural form. Its dark green summer foliage provides summer interest and turns rich bronze in fall, adding seasonal color. Its naturally tall, slender shape makes it ideal for streetscapes, formal gardens, or as a vertical accent in smaller landscapes.
Valued for urban adaptability, architectural form, and low-maintenance growth, it grows best in full sun and prefers well-drained, fertile soil. Minimal pruning is needed, primarily to remove dead or crossing branches.
| Fall Colour | Golden Brown |
|---|---|
| Shape | Narrow Pyamidal |
| Sun Exposure | Full Sun |
| Fruit | Acorn |
| Latin Name | Quercus robur v. Fastigiata |
| Soil Conditions | Moist / Well Drained |
| Flower Colour | Catkins |
| Mature Height ** | 15 Meters - 49 Feet |
| Mature Width ** | 5 Meters - 16 Feet |
| Growth Rate | Average |
| Zone | 5 |
| Native | No |
** Maturity Heights and Widths are listed to show what this plant can grow to in warmer climates and over the course of centuries. For landscape purposes in Ontario, take this value at 50% for appropriate spacing in your garden for immediate install purposes / for the next 10-20 years.
